Product Performance and Advantages
Efficient Defoaming and Foam Inhibition:
In solvent - based and solvent - free printing inks and overprint varnish systems, it can quickly eliminate foam generated during production and filling processes and inhibit the formation of new foam. For example, during high - speed printing, a large amount of foam is easily generated due to the rapid flow of ink. BYK - 1752 can quickly play a role, ensuring the smooth printing process and avoiding printing defects (such as dot deformation, uneven ink color, etc.) caused by foam.
Good Compatibility:
It has good compatibility with various resin systems of solvent - based and solvent - free inks and overprint varnishes. It will not have adverse reactions with other components in the system, nor will it affect the color, gloss, drying speed and other properties of the ink or varnish itself, ensuring the stable quality of the final product.
Does Not Affect Recoating Performance:
In processes that require multiple coatings, the defoamer will not reduce the adhesion between coatings. For example, when applying overprint varnish to metal products, even if multiple recoatings are performed, the coatings can still be firmly bonded without delamination, peeling and other phenomena.
Wide Range of Applications:
It is not only suitable for printing inks and overprint varnishes, but also can be used in some similar systems that require foam control, such as certain special industrial coatings, adhesives, etc., providing diversified foam solutions for different industries.

Usage and Storage Recommendations
Adding Method:
The recommended dosage is 0.1% - 0.5% of the total formula amount. It can be directly added during the stirring process of ink or varnish production, and ensure sufficient and uniform stirring to achieve the best defoaming effect. If the system viscosity is high, it can be diluted appropriately before adding.
Compatibility Test:
When using it for the first time or changing to a new raw material system, it is recommended to conduct a small - scale test first to test the compatibility of BYK - 1752 with other components in the system, and observe whether phenomena such as turbidity and precipitation occur, as well as the impact on the performance of the final product.
Storage Conditions:
It should be stored in a cool and dry environment with a temperature maintained at 5 - 35℃, avoiding direct sunlight and high temperatures. After opening, it should be sealed for storage to prevent the product from getting damp or contaminated. The shelf life of unopened products is generally 12 months.
